LIMA, Dec 21 (Reuters) – Peru suspended flights from Europe for 2 weeks and has put its well being and journey authorities on excessive alert to forestall the entry of a brand new pressure of coronavirus that appeared in the UK, President Francisco Sagasti stated on Monday.
Sagasti stated no direct flights from the UK had entered the nation since December 15, when flights from Europe restarted. However well being authorities had been monitoring passengers from Britain who had entered by connecting flights, he stated.
British Prime Minister Boris Johnson stated final week {that a} new pressure of the coronavirus had led to surging an infection numbers, prompting international locations worldwide to droop flights to and from the UK.
The announcement comes as hard-hit Peru nears a million instances of COVID-19, amid rising issues over a second wave of the virus following the end-of-year holidays.
Well being officers in Peru have prohibited using non-public autos on Dec. 24, 25 and 31, in addition to on New 12 months’s Day to cut back motion, and have discouraged Peruvians from visiting household over the vacations.
Along with suspending flights from the UK, Peru on Monday additionally prohibited the entry of non-resident foreigners who had been within the UK in the final two weeks. Peruvians or non-residents already within the nation who had not too long ago visited the UK can be required to spend 14 days in isolation.
Coronavirus instances in Peru hit 997,517 on Sunday, with 37,103 deaths from the illness, based on official figures.
Peru has already signed a preliminary settlement with Pfizer to purchase 9.9 million doses of its vaccine, and inked a agency cope with the Covax Facility, an alliance led by the World Well being Group, to accumulate one other 13.2 million doses.
Sagasti’s authorities stated final week it didn’t know when the primary doses can be arriving within the Andean nation, nor what number of can be included within the first cargo.
